A conviction for a sex crime can alter a person's life forever. The penalties for these charges can be unrelentingly severe, involving potential jail time and both extensive therapy under supervised probation and registration with Maryland's Sexual Offender Registry. A registered sexual offender must stay in routine contact with the state, keeping it regularly apprised of residence and other personal details. Status as a registered sexual offender can also affect important matters such as a convicted person's professional license, employment, and parental rights.
